Mockingbird heard you're singing across the lake. A vision of hope without a house or a home Mockingbird there's no fish alive in this here lake They were poisoned dead by a pesticide windblown Mockingbird the Kingfisher doesn't know what to do. Mockingbird the white owl, is crying and hooting every- day. Have some sympathy; please, less booboo. Mockingbird, what is wrong with you? Love and convulsions fill my heart with waves. I guess I am drowning between these islands. Lying in the morning, dew plummeting malaise With creatures, you shouldn't even fantasise. Mockingbird, don't you know there's a circle of life? Like a cobweb sleeping in the dark, dead night, ebony That will one day catch your soul. And never let you fly or let even you go. Mockingbird heard you're singing across the lake. A vision of hope without a house or a home But I still prayed for your soul. An end to all your woes.
